Wedbush Reaffirms Outperform Rating for Xencor (NASDAQ:XNCR)

Wedbush reissued their outperform rating on shares of Xencor (NASDAQ:XNCRFree Report) in a report issued on Thursday morning, RTT News reports. Wedbush currently has a $34.00 price objective on the biopharmaceutical company’s stock, down from their prior price objective of $36.00.

Several other brokerages have also recently issued reports on XNCR. Piper Sandler reaffirmed a neutral rating and issued a $24.00 target price (down from $37.00) on shares of Xencor in a report on Wednesday, February 28th. BTIG Research dropped their price target on Xencor from $56.00 to $38.00 and set a buy rating for the company in a research report on Tuesday, April 16th. Royal Bank of Canada reiterated an outperform rating and issued a $32.00 price target on shares of Xencor in a research report on Wednesday, February 28th. StockNews.com upgraded Xencor from a sell rating to a hold rating in a research report on Saturday, March 9th. Finally, BMO Capital Markets dropped their price target on Xencor from $38.00 to $34.00 and set an outperform rating for the company in a research report on Wednesday, February 28th. Two investment anal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, six have assigned a buy rating and one has issued a strong buy rating to the stock. According to MarketBeat, the stock presently has an average rating of Moderate Buy and an average target price of $35.38.

Xencor Price Performance

NASDAQ:XNCR opened at $20.58 on Thursday. The company has a quick ratio of 7.08, a current ratio of 7.08 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.02. The business’s 50-day simple moving average is $21.88 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$21.50. The stock has a market cap of $1.27 billion, a PE ratio of -9.40 and a beta of 0.82. Xencor has a 52 week low of $16.49 and a 52 week high of $26.84.

Xencor (NASDAQ:XNCRG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, May 9th. The biopharmaceutical company reported ($1.11)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.83) by ($0.28). Xencor had a negative return on equity of 20.29% and a negative net margin of 82.23%. The firm had revenue of $12.80 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$23.07 million. During the same period last year, the firm posted ($1.02) earnings per share. The company’s revenue for the quarter was down 32.3%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, analysts forecast that Xencor will post -3.5 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Xencor

Xencor, Inc, a clinical stage biopharmaceutical company, focuses on the discovery and development of engineered monoclonal antibody and cytokine therapeutics to treat patients with cancer and autoimmune diseases. The company provides Sotrovimab that targets the SARS-CoV-2 virus; Ultomiris for the treatment of patients with pa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ria and atypical hemolytic uremic syndrome; and Monjuvi for the treatment of patients with relapsed or refractory diffuse large B-cell lymphoma.
